Linux 常见命令 --文件处理命令

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Linux 常见命令 --文件处理命令相关的知识,希望对你有一定的参考价值。

使用 Ctrl+L进行清屏 快捷键

Linux 当中一切皆文件,目录也是文件,我们称之为目录文件,目录文件和普通文件有区别,普通文件是用来保存数据的,而目录是用来保存文件的,目录的概念就是windows中的文件夹的概念

(1)目录处理命名

1.  建立目录: mkdir(make directories)

     mkdir -p[目录名]   -p  递归创建

2. 切换目录(change directory)  pwd 显示  当前所在的目录

简化操作:

cd ~  : 进入当前用户的家目录

cd  [目录] 进入到指定目录  cd 直接回车  回到 家目录

cd - 进入上次目录

cd .. 进入上一级目录

cd . 进入当前目录

相对路径 和绝对路径

相对路径: 参照 当前所在目录,进行查找

绝对路径: 从根目录开始指定,一级一级递归查找,在任何目录下,都能进入指定位置

3. 查询所在目录位置: pwd(print working directory) 打印工作目录 显示所在位置

4 删除空目录 rmdir [目录名] ( remove empty directories) 使用很少(删除文件一定要小心)

  rm 可以删除文件或者目录   : 都可以  rm -rf [文件或目录]

     习惯使用  (rm -rf  [文件和目录])

  rm -rf a* : 可以删除已a 开头的文件  复制和删除目录的时候  必须带有-r  可是在移动目录或给目录文件重命名时

不需要带-r

  rm -rf [文件或目录]  使用该命令  r 的意思是删除目录 (会询问)  f 强制删除 (rm -rf  / 千万不能执行,让Linux自杀  linux 的root 是真正的root 真正意义上的管理员) rm -rf a*

  rm -rf  /tmp/* (加 * 代表的是删除目录下的内容 ,不加*代表的是删除系统目录)

  创建空文件的命令 touch abc

(5)复制命令  cp [选项] [源文件或目录] [目的目录]

  复制和 删除 目录都需要 加上 -r

        选项 : 

      -r  复制目录  不加-r 是复制文件

      -p 连带文件属性复制

      -d 若文件是链接文件,则复制链接属性

      -a 相当于 -pdr  (所有的隐藏属性 都一样)

ll 命令是 ls -l 命令的简写(ls -l  是ll 别名关系)

(6)剪切或改名命令  : mv  (move)

mv [源文件或目录] [目标目录] 这个都不用用 -r

 常用目录的作用 :  (常用的一级目录的作用)

/     根目录  讲解和熟悉 一级目录的作用

根目录的 bin 和sbin,usr 目录下的bin 和sbin 这四个目录都是用来保存系统命令的(bin 目录下 所有用户都能执行)

(sbin目录 下的命令只有超级管理员才能执行)

/bin 命令保存目录(普通用户就可以读取的命令)

/boot 启动目录,启动相关文件

/dev 设备文件保存目录

/etc 配置文件保存目录

/home 普通用户的家目录

/lib  系统库保存目录

/mnt 系统挂载目录

/media  挂载目录

 

Date : 显示文件的时间

 (2)目录文件命令

(3)链接命令

以上是关于Linux 常见命令 --文件处理命令的主要内容,如果未能解决你的问题,请参考以下文章

Linux常见命令

linux常见命令

Linux常见命令

linux命令2—常见linux命令

Linux基础之Linux常见命令

Linux常见命令